Transaction 51ed1702d5c5f8e2a9c19c37d16af1f69424a687e4dc61a3eb892985880d51f8
1 Input
2 Outputs
- 51ed1702d5c5f8e2a9c19c37d16af1f69424a687e4dc61a3eb892985880d51f8:0
- 51ed1702d5c5f8e2a9c19c37d16af1f69424a687e4dc61a3eb892985880d51f8:1
value 582320757
address msdUFJRzn6LLQnsjMRj2cg4dcFYfy4i4pK
value 667989251
address n2eMqTT929pb1RDNuqEnxdaLau1rxy3efi